Abstract

This paper establishes the strong primeness of all Jordan systemsJof hermitian type, trapped between ample hermitian elements of a ∗-prime associative systemRand its Martindale system of symmetric quotientsQ(R):H0(R,∗)⊆J⊆H(Q(R),∗). This completes the converse of Zelmanov's classification of strongly prime Jordan systems, providing “if” as well as “only if” classifications of strongly prime and primitive Jordan systems.
